The Evolution of Simulation Games

Simulation games have evolved significantly over the years. From simple management games to intricate life simulations, they offer a unique experience that can lead players into the deeper mechanics of RPGs. Each game presents opportunities for players to develop skills, strategies, and even narratives.

Key Features of Simulation Games

  • Realism: They often mimic real-life scenarios, providing a sense of authenticity.
  • Strategic Planning: Players create plans that can translate directly into RPG mechanics.
  • Creative Freedom: Many simulation games allow players to build or customize their worlds.

Understanding the Transition to RPG

For those who have enjoyed simulation games, venturing into RPGs feels familiar. The mechanics of character development, story progression, and world-building are often something simulation players have already touched upon. This familiarity can make the transition smoother and more enjoyable.

Simulation Games that Perfectly Set Up for RPGs

Some notable simulation games include:

Game Title RPG Elements
Two Point Hospital Character development, resource management
Animal Crossing Customizable characters, world-building
Stardew Valley Questing, character interactions

Community and Multiplayer Aspects

Many simulation games include an online multiplayer aspect. This allows players to interact, collaborate, and compete, emphasizing the community-driven experience that RPGs often have. Forming alliances and strategizing with others deepens the gameplay.

Character Customization

One highlight of both genres is character customization. Simulation games often provide tools and options that mimic the personal storytelling aspect of RPGs. Players invest time in creating a character, allowing for emotional investment even before venturing into RPGs.

Learning Through Simulation

Simulation games are not just entertaining; they serve as learning tools. They can teach important skills like resource management, strategic thinking, and interpersonal communication. These skills can translate into gameplay mechanics in RPGs, enhancing the overall playing experience.

How Simulation Games Prepare Players for RPG Challenges

Players who engage with simulation games may find themselves better prepared for the challenges of RPGs. Understanding resource management, character interactions, and even building strategies can significantly enhance their RPG experience.

The Role of Narrative in Simulation Games

Narrative structure is often woven into simulation games. This aspect can introduce players to storytelling, offering a gateway into the complex narratives found in RPGs. Players learn to appreciate character arcs and plot development.

Exploring Game Mechanics

Familiarity with game mechanics is crucial for new players. Simulation games often share similar mechanics with RPGs like inventory systems, dialogue choices, and skill progression. This shared language can help bridge the gap.
